Woody Allen: Selects 'Slumdog' star for next film
Woody Allen has selected the actress Freida Pinto, the star of "Slumdog Millionaire", for his next film.
Freida Pinto, the film's luminous leading lady who has been wowing the world on the red carpet and across television interviews lining up to the Slumdog's Oscar glory, has signed for a role in Woody Allen’s next mega movie project in Hollywood. She will join Anthony Hopkins, Naomi Watts and Josh Brolin in the still-to-be-titled movie for which shooting will begin this year.
Woody Allen, one of America's iconic directors has undoubtedly created some of the most memorable female characters in cinema. His classic movies are "Annie Hall", "Crimes and Misdemeanours", "Husbands and Wives" and "Bullets Over Broadway".
Woody Allen, a three-time Oscar winner, has propelled numerous actresses on to Oscar glory. Aside from Cruz, Mira Sorvino also won an Oscar for her role in Mighty Aphrodite. Dianne Wiest received an Academy Award for Hannah and Her Sisters and Bullets Over Broadway, while Diane Keaton, who starred in numerous films by Allen, won an Oscar for Annie Hall in 1977.
